Espresso Martini
The espresso martini is a cocktail name familiar to all but the most inexperienced of drinkers
but it wasn’t always known as such
Invented by Dick Bradsell back in 1983 during his tenure at the Soho Brasserie
it was originally christened the “Vodka Espresso”.
Cocktail legend has it that a young,
future supermodel sidled up to the bar and asked Dick to make her a cocktail with coffee.
He mixed her a drink using vodka, sugar, coffee liqueur and a shot of espresso,
pulled from the coffee machine next to his station
It’s a story that has helped the drink retain an edginess that many modern cocktails have failed to replicate
